    I finally got around to getting all the pictures together from our trip to austin. Thanks to our good friend Josh Kurpius and my girlfriend Kacy for the photography. Most of the pics are from the trip and not from the show considering we spent more time traveling then in austin.


    What started out as a last minute trip to the Lone Star Round Up turned into the adventure of the year. I wish I could say that we made it to the show but we didnt roll into town until around 6 oclock saturday night. We left chicago thursday morning around 9 oclock.

    we started off the trip with four cars.


    We didnt make it 30 min from home when Cleens fuel pump took a shit and he needed to remove his shocks.

    And off we were back on the road in about 20 minutes. And then we get stopped out side of Springfield Illinois for passing a supreme court judge doing what he said was 85mph.

    The officer was really nice and let us off with a warning.

    My exhaust came loose about an hour later. Which was a simple fix.

    Off again, we drove for about 7 hours and made it to springfield mo. When I threw a rod through my oil pan. That was the end of the trip for my 52 chevy.

    Thanks to my good friend Tuck for posting a hamb sos. Brian (studesled) and his father (Flamed58) was there to our rescue in less than an hour with a trailer. Thats why the hamb kicks ass.

    We decided to stay in springfield that night so we headed over to Flamed58s house where he let us use his garage and tools. Stitch's car broke a cheep piece of shit speedway hairpin. So I welded that up for him while Cleen did some minor maintance.

    After eating some pizza we hit the road and into a heavy thunderstorm with tornado and hail warnings. We drove for about three hours deeper and deeper into the storm. Cleens car took on so much water it quit running…….I have never been so soaked in my life. Thank god for Nick bringing the ponchos……. They didn’t do a damn thing the rain was coming down sideways and blowing the ponchos off.

    We got up early in the morning hoping Cleens car had dried out. But it didn’t. So we resorted to a hair drier to dry out his distributor.

    Once we got to Austin we didn’t take very many pictures (we do have a lot of video but I cant figure out how to post them) we just enjoyed ourselves as much as possible.

    We hitched a ride home with Johnny Cola because the rest of our group went to Vagas.

    I have to say even though we had a rough ride I couldn’t have asked for a better trip. We got to meet so many nice people and stay at some very interesting places. No we didn’t make it to the Round Up but it didn’t matter because Austin is a kick ass town and maybe next year we will leave a few days earlier to try to make the show. We are looking forward to another adventure to Austin that’s for sure.
